I am installing my old Sh*tsubishi Lancer Stock stereo into my little 9 foot pond hopper. I have everything wired up prosfessionally, got the old harness new from Best Buy (my job), and and ready to solder onto the harness. I wire everything up to check the connections, including the power and ground, and it does not turn on.
I am running power from a 12v deep cycle battery wired all throughout the boat, in addition I have attached the negative from the battery to the stereo's body. Is there any theft protection or anything I am missing out. There is a postive and negative in the harness but no ground (not that I have one on the boat, the negative i assume).
On the back of the radio, it has two round attenna ports (i believe thats what they are) a harness port, for the harness I am usuing, and on the back left bottom there is a round (alot of pins) connection, but I dont remember anything ever being hooked up to that. Maybe a 6 disc?
Anyway, what am I forgetting, doing wrong?
